About Mint Project
"MINT" as in mint condition, "PROJECT" as in the process of design - is an industrial, graphic design, creative branding studio specializing in lifestyle, action sports, and performance outdoor brands. What Is the Cost of Living Near Dover?

Understanding the cost of living near Dover is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Mint Project.
Dover's Cost of Living Index is approximately 105.1 (5.1% more expensive than US average; 0.5% less than NH average). Seacoast region city, housing near US average. COAST bus, Amtrak. When planning your budget based on a salary from Mint Project, consider these typical monthly expenses:
